當(dāng)前位置 主頁 > 技術(shù)大全 >
而Linux操作系統(tǒng),憑借其高效、穩(wěn)定、開源等特性,在服務(wù)器領(lǐng)域占據(jù)了舉足輕重的地位
在Linux系統(tǒng)中,磁盤分區(qū)管理直接關(guān)系到系統(tǒng)的性能、數(shù)據(jù)安全以及資源分配
因此,掌握如何查看系統(tǒng)分區(qū)情況,對于每位運(yùn)維人員來說都至關(guān)重要
本文將詳細(xì)介紹如何使用Xshell這一強(qiáng)大的遠(yuǎn)程登錄工具,來查看Linux系統(tǒng)中的分區(qū)信息,同時(shí)深入分析相關(guān)命令和概念,為初學(xué)者和進(jìn)階用戶提供一份詳盡的指南
一、Xshell簡介 Xshell是一款功能強(qiáng)大的終端模擬軟件,它支持SSH、SFTP等多種協(xié)議,使得用戶能夠輕松、安全地連接到遠(yuǎn)程服務(wù)器
無論是Windows、macOS還是Linux平臺(tái),Xshell都能提供流暢的操作體驗(yàn)
通過Xshell,用戶可以像在本地機(jī)器上一樣,執(zhí)行各種命令行操作,如文件傳輸、系統(tǒng)監(jiān)控、配置管理等
對于需要頻繁訪問遠(yuǎn)程服務(wù)器的運(yùn)維人員來說,Xshell無疑是提升工作效率的利器
二、為何需要查看分區(qū)信息 在Linux系統(tǒng)中,硬盤被劃分為多個(gè)邏輯單元,即分區(qū)
每個(gè)分區(qū)可以獨(dú)立格式化,并掛載到文件系統(tǒng)的不同位置
查看分區(qū)信息對于系統(tǒng)管理員來說至關(guān)重要,原因有以下幾點(diǎn): 1.性能優(yōu)化:合理的分區(qū)布局可以提高磁盤讀寫效率,優(yōu)化系統(tǒng)性能
2.數(shù)據(jù)管理:了解各個(gè)分區(qū)的使用情況,有助于制定備份策略,防止數(shù)據(jù)丟失
3.故障排除:當(dāng)系統(tǒng)出現(xiàn)磁盤空間不足或分區(qū)損壞等問題時(shí),快速定位并解決問題
4.系統(tǒng)升級(jí)與擴(kuò)容:在進(jìn)行系統(tǒng)升級(jí)或擴(kuò)容前,需要評(píng)估現(xiàn)有分區(qū)情況,確保新操作不會(huì)破壞現(xiàn)有數(shù)據(jù)
三、使用Xshell查看分區(qū)信息的步驟 1. 連接遠(yuǎn)程服務(wù)器 首先,打開Xshell軟件,點(diǎn)擊左上角的“新建”按鈕,輸入遠(yuǎn)程服務(wù)器的IP地址、端口號(hào)(默認(rèn)為22)、用戶名和密碼(或選擇使用密鑰認(rèn)證)
配置完成后,點(diǎn)擊“連接”即可成功登錄到遠(yuǎn)程Linux服務(wù)器
2.使用`df`命令查看掛載點(diǎn)信息 登錄后,輸入以下命令查看當(dāng)前掛載的分區(qū)及其使用情況: df -h `-h`選項(xiàng)表示以人類可讀的格式顯示輸出,如GB、MB等
該命令會(huì)列出所有已掛載的文件系統(tǒng),包括它們的總大小、已用空間、可用空間、使用率以及掛載點(diǎn)
3.使用`lsblk`命令查看塊設(shè)備信息 為了更詳細(xì)地了解磁盤分區(qū)情況,可以使用`lsblk`命令: lsblk -f `-f`選項(xiàng)會(huì)顯示文件系統(tǒng)類型、UUID等額外信息
`lsblk`命令以樹狀結(jié)構(gòu)展示了所有塊設(shè)備(包括硬盤、分區(qū)、光盤等)的層級(jí)關(guān)系,以及它們的掛載點(diǎn)和文件系統(tǒng)類型
4.使用`fdisk`或`parted`查看分區(qū)表 對于需要深入了解分區(qū)布局的用戶,可以使用`fdisk`或`parted`命令直接查看磁盤的分區(qū)表
這里以`fdisk`為例: sudo fdisk -l 注意,`fdisk`操作可能需要超級(jí)用戶權(quán)限,因此前面加上了`sudo`
該命令會(huì)列出所有磁盤及其分區(qū)信息,包括分區(qū)類型(如主分區(qū)、擴(kuò)展分區(qū)、邏輯分區(qū))、起始和結(jié)束扇區(qū)、大小等
5.使用`blkid`查看塊設(shè)備ID 有時(shí)候,你可能需要知道某個(gè)分區(qū)的UUID或文件系統(tǒng)類型,這時(shí)可以使用`blkid`命令: sudo blkid 該命令列出了所有塊設(shè)備的UUID、文件系統(tǒng)類型等信息,這對于配置`/etc/fstab`文件,實(shí)現(xiàn)開機(jī)自動(dòng)掛載非常有用
四、深入理解分區(qū)類型與文件系統(tǒng) 在Linux系統(tǒng)中,分區(qū)類型通常分為基本分區(qū)(Primary Partition)、擴(kuò)展分區(qū)(Extended Partition)和邏輯分區(qū)(Logical Partition)
基本分區(qū)最多只能有4個(gè),而擴(kuò)展分區(qū)可以包含多個(gè)邏輯分區(qū)
此外,Linux還支持LVM(邏輯卷管理),它提供了更靈活的磁盤管理方式
文件系統(tǒng)方面,Linux支持多種文件系統(tǒng)類型,如ext4、xfs、btrfs等
每種文件系統(tǒng)都有其獨(dú)特的優(yōu)點(diǎn)和適用場景
例如,ext4是最常用的Linux文件系統(tǒng)之一,它提供了良好的性能、穩(wěn)定性和兼容性;而xfs則更適合大數(shù)據(jù)量和高并發(fā)訪問的場景
五、實(shí)踐案例與故障排除 案例一:磁盤空間不足 假設(shè)你發(fā)現(xiàn)某個(gè)分區(qū)的使用率非常高,接近100%,這時(shí)可以采取以下措施: 1.清理無用文件:使用du命令查找大文件或無用文件,并刪除它們
2.增加分區(qū)大小:如果可能,可以通過調(diào)整分區(qū)大小或使用LVM來擴(kuò)展分區(qū)容量
3.檢查日志文件:有時(shí)日志文件會(huì)占用大量空間,檢查并清理或歸檔舊日志
案例二:分區(qū)損壞 如果某個(gè)分區(qū)出現(xiàn)損壞,可能會(huì)導(dǎo)致數(shù)據(jù)丟失或系統(tǒng)無法啟動(dòng)
此時(shí),可以嘗試以下步驟: 1.使用fsck修復(fù)文件系統(tǒng):對于非掛載狀態(tài)的分區(qū),可以使用`fsck`命令嘗試修復(fù)文件系統(tǒng)錯(cuò)誤
2.備份數(shù)據(jù):如果分區(qū)仍能訪問,盡快備份重要數(shù)據(jù)
3.恢復(fù)或重建分區(qū):如果修復(fù)失敗,可能需要考慮從備份恢復(fù)數(shù)據(jù)或重新分區(qū)
六、總結(jié) 通過本文的介紹,我們了解了如何使用Xshell這一遠(yuǎn)程登錄工具來查看Linux系統(tǒng)中的分區(qū)信息
掌握了`df`、`lsblk`、`fdisk`、`parted`和`blkid`等關(guān)鍵命令的使用,以及分區(qū)類型與文件系統(tǒng)的基本概念
這些知識(shí)和技能對于系統(tǒng)管理員來說至關(guān)重要,它們不僅能夠幫助我們更好地管理系統(tǒng)資源,還能在遇到問題時(shí)